About Adoption Law in Envigado, Colombia

Adoption in Envigado, Colombia, is regulated by the Colombian Family Code and other relevant laws. The purpose of adoption is to provide a secure and nurturing environment for children who are unable to be raised by their biological parents. It is a legal process that establishes a permanent parent-child relationship between the adoptive parents and the child.

Local Laws Overview

Some key aspects of adoption laws in Envigado, Colombia include:

  • Adoption is open to both married couples and single individuals.
  • Adoptive parents must be at least 25 years old and at least 15 years older than the child they wish to adopt.
  • Consent from the biological parents or legal guardians is required for adoption, except in cases of abandonment or termination of parental rights.
  • A comprehensive home study assessment is conducted to evaluate the suitability of prospective adoptive parents.
  • The adoption process involves obtaining a declaration of adoptability, followed by an adoption decree from the family court.

Frequently Asked Questions

Q: Who can adopt in Envigado, Colombia?

A: Married couples and single individuals who meet the eligibility criteria can adopt in Envigado, Colombia.

Q: Are there any age requirements for adoptive parents?

A: Yes, adoptive parents must be at least 25 years old and at least 15 years older than the child they wish to adopt.

Q: Do I need the consent of the biological parents to adopt?

A: In most cases, yes. Consent from the biological parents or legal guardians is generally required for adoption. However, there are exceptions in cases of abandonment or termination of parental rights.

Q: What is a home study assessment?

A: A home study assessment is a comprehensive evaluation of the prospective adoptive parents' suitability and ability to provide a stable and nurturing environment for the child. It involves interviews, background checks, home visits, and documentation verification.

Q: What is the process for adopting a child in Envigado, Colombia?

A: The adoption process involves several steps, including obtaining a declaration of adoptability from the family court, completing a home study assessment, attending mandatory adoption workshops, and ultimately obtaining an adoption decree from the family court.
